2541  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: How to avoid Dump after listing on: January 14, 2019, 04:26:18 PM
At the time of the listing after the end of ICO, the price often dumps. Why does it happen?
I think the reason is there is no buyer because of no demand for tokens since the ecosystem is not completed after the ICO.
It may be difficult because lack of funds, but I think the team should release a product like Dapps while running ICO to make token demand.
How do you think about it?

I totally agree, however, there's no way to stop dump once a token/coin gets listed. Some investors/ bounty hunters want quick profit especially if the price on the exchange is really favorable. Projects are aware about this that is why some tokens are locked in a certain amount of time to avoid price dump.

2543  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: Who dump coins early; Bounty hunters or ICO investors? on: January 14, 2019, 12:54:25 PM
Its so sad when we have been made to believe its bounty hunters who dump their bounty tokens immediately after ICO and so devalue the coins on the market. Because of this notion, project managers these days try to delay bounty rewards while some even go ahead to give small rewards so that the actions of bounty hunters will not affect the price of their coins. Now I participated in this bounty and we were paid late as usual. We went to the market and realized the price was already down, even below the ICO price. So who caused it ? I think we should have a second look at this issue. Don't you think its the investors who get bonuses during the ICO who try to dump their bonuses for profit and not the bounty hunters as we have been made to believe?. Let me hear your opinions guys

Bounties are usually just almost from .5-5% of the total supply of a project. So, I guess, it is too small to really affect the price of a coin/token once it is distributed. I don't know why some admins or even investors are blaming or bounty hunters for the decline in price. There are a lot of investors who have a huge chunk of tokens because they bought it at early stage where discount and offers are massive.
